Publisher's Synopsis
Seventeen-year-old track star Annie Lucas is too young to remember her dad's glory days as a Yankees pitcher. So when a family friend offers him a coaching position with the Kansas City Royals, Annie is intrigued by the idea of seeing the baseball side of her dad. Knowing that he'll be mentoring nineteen-year-old rookie phenom Jason Brody is just a bonus. After an awkward first meeting with Brody involving a towel, very little clothing, and a much-too-personal locker room interview, Annie's conviced she knows his type - arrogant, bossy, and most likely not into high school girls. But as he and her father grow closer, Annie starts to see through his façade to the lonely boy in over his head beneath.
